On the limiting thickness of the Perovskite-like block in the Aurivillius phases in the Bi$_2$O$_3$–Fe$_2$O$_3$–TiO$_2$ system

N. A. Lomanovaa, V. V. Gusarovab

a Ioffe Institute, St. Petersburg
b State Technological Institute of St. Petersburg (Technical University)

Abstract: The stability of the Aurivillius phases in the system Bi$_2$O$_3$–Fe$_2$O$_3$–TiO$_2$ was investigated. Structural and physicochemical parameters, allowing to calculate the limits of the length of the homologous series of the compounds Bi$_{n+1}$Fe$_{n-3}$Ti$_3$O$_{3n+3}$ were identified. It was found that the maximum thickness of a perovskite-like block of these compounds is $\sim$3.7 nm.
